World's oldest person dies aged 117

The oldest person in the world, Violet Mosse-Brown, passed away at the age of 117 on Friday. Brown, who was born in Jamaica on March 10, 1900, suffered from an irregular heartbeat and was dehydrated days before she passed away. Following her death, 117-year-old Japanese woman Nabi Tajima, born on August 4, 1900, has become the world's oldest person.
